Grow Therapy – $150M
Mental Health
Grow Therapy, an online therapy platform for virtual or in-person therapy with licensed therapists, has raised $150M in Series D funding led by TCV and Goldman Sachs. Founded by Alan Ni, Jake Cooper, and Manoj Kanagaraj in 2020, Grow Therapy has now raised a total of $298M in reported equity funding.
Sage – $65M
Senior Care
Sage, an integrated care platform built for senior living and skilled nursing facilities, has raised $65M in Series C funding led by Growth Equity at Goldman Sachs Alternatives. Founded by Ellen Johnston, Matthew Lynch, and Raj Mehra in 2020, Sage has now raised a total of $124M in reported equity funding.

Eight Sleep – $50M
Sleep Tech
Eight Sleep, the makers of a sleep system designed for deeper recovery on any bed, has raised $50M in additional funding led by Tether Ventures. Founded by Alexandra Zatarain, Andrea Ballarini, Massimo Andreasi Bassi, and Matteo Franceschetti in 2014, Eight Sleep has now raised a total of $312.1M in reported equity funding.
Cryptio – $44.5M
Crypto
Cryptio, a back-office platform for digital assets transforming data into auditable records, has raised $44.5M in funding according to a recent SEC filing. The filing indicates that the round comes from six investors. Founded by Antoine Scalia in 2018, Cryptio has now raised a total of $60.7M in reported equity funding.
Antioch – $8.4M
Robotics
Antioch, a simulation infrastructure platform to test and validate robotics and autonomous systems in software before deploying to real hardware, has raised $8.4M in funding according to a recent SEC filing. The filing indicates that the round comes from eighteen investors. Founded by Harry Mellsop, Alex Langshur, Colton Swingl, and Collin Schlager in 2025, Antioch has now raised a total of $12.7M in reported equity funding.
Traversal – $5M
AI
Traversal, an AI-powered site reliability engineering platform for even the most complex incidents, has raised $5M in additional funding from investors that include Amex Ventures. Founded by Raaz Dwivedi, Raj Agrawal, Ahmed Lone, and Anish Agarwal in 2023, Traversal has now raised a total of $53M in reported equity funding.

Chptr – $3.25M
Funeral Tech
Chptr, a storytelling platform helping funeral homes share memorial stories with the communities they serve, has raised $3.25M in funding according to a recent SEC filing. The filing indicates that the total offering is for $5M and there were eighteen investors in this close. Founded by Rehan Choudhry in 2021, Chptr has now raised a total of $7.15M in reported equity funding.
